Transaction 57f44e152f0f831ab66eb6b4053e6f514ba25c6b9302636bca1a05ec29f540cd

1 Input
2 Outputs
  • 57f44e152f0f831ab66eb6b4053e6f514ba25c6b9302636bca1a05ec29f540cd:0
  • value  1438162
    address  1K5aDC68j6fVneRTf2d93h1D7wLYsL1baB
  • 57f44e152f0f831ab66eb6b4053e6f514ba25c6b9302636bca1a05ec29f540cd:1
  • value  17039
    address  bc1qsxzhynkuffdxms2jwjxh750hqu5jmfgwt9sdpz